Gheis Mohammadi

Over an 18-month period, contributed to the harmony-one/h repository by engineering core blockchain infrastructure focused on P2P networking, stream synchronization, and Ethereum compatibility. Leveraging Go and Markdown, delivered features such as adaptive stream sync, EIP-2537 BLS cryptography integration, and hard fork readiness, while addressing bugs in EVM tracing and delegation logic. Enhanced system resilience through protocol refactoring, concurrency management, and improved observability with Prometheus metrics and robust documentation. Prioritized deployment safety and validator reliability by refining consensus mechanisms, slashing validation, and network stability. Maintained disciplined progress reporting and technical writing to support release planning, onboarding, and cross-team collaboration.

Month: 2025-05. Delivered P2P networking reliability and stream management enhancements for harmony-one/h, focusing on stability, performance, and observability. Implementations include disabling libp2p resource manager, read deadlines, tunable stream parameters, updated P2P muxers, enhanced stream lifecycle tracking, improved thread safety, memory-leak prevention, new Prometheus metrics, throttling, and proper cleanup of requests. Also fixed a bug in download logic. Result: more reliable peer-to-peer data transfer under load, clearer operational visibility, and safer memory usage.

April 2025: Focused on stabilizing and accelerating streaming in harmony-one/h. Delivered Staged Stream Sync Reliability and Performance Improvements by simplifying staged stream sync, removing redundant block processing, and adopting a pull-based worker model for block body downloads. Refactored the stream request manager, isolated health checks, tuned timeouts, and addressed concurrency issues to deliver a more robust streaming experience with fewer failures and easier maintenance. This work enhances reliability for downstream consumers and reduces operational toil.
